Subject: Key rotation following the FD-leak investigation

Hi — while hunting the leaked file descriptors in the Copperlane ingest worker, we found the old Tallowgrid service key logged in a debug dump. Out of caution we rotated it tonight. Please review the attached patch closing the descriptors and confirm nothing else echoes credentials. For your local verification run against staging, use the replacement key below.

service key, bawip-kawip: zpat4_kOcB

Subject: Handover — Coldpath release signing

Hi,

Before you review the Coldpath changes, note that our serverless handlers now pre-warm via the Fennick scheduler, cutting cold starts roughly in half. The warm-pool config ships with each release bundle, so every deploy must be signed or the scheduler rejects it. Please verify signatures against the key below.

signing key of baduf-kafog = bky6_Azw6Lf

## Step 6 — Currency Rounding Patch (Ledgervane 4.1)

Before promoting the build, verify that `LV_ROUNDING_MODE` is set to `bankers` in every region's env file. Earlier releases defaulted to truncation, which produced one-cent discrepancies on high-volume conversions and triggered reconciliation alerts. The fix only activates when the mode flag and the conversion service's signing secret are both present. Confirm the flag, then ensure the secret appears on the line immediately following it:

vault entry, yahif-yajep: COURIER_KEY29=b802bdf8034096b65a51c6ba5abe2

Quarterly Planning Note — Gross-Margin Review

Quick update for the board: margins at Brightholm Supply ticked up to 41%, mostly thanks to the packaging renegotiation Dela pushed through. The Kestrel line is still soft, and we're trimming two low-volume SKUs to stop the bleed. Q4 focus is freight consolidation and smarter discount gates. Full deck to follow at the meeting, but one confidential point needs flagging first.

board note of tawig-bajof: The renewal with Ralixix Holdings closes at $10 million a year, 20 percent above the last contract. Project Druix slips by two quarters because of the tooling delay.